I was not aware of AssertValue. It looks really cool, to be honest. The difference I can see is that the assertion value is stored in the test itself, not in a separate file. It has its benefits and drawbacks. Another difference would be that AssertValue is interactive, whereas Snapshy is not. It’s not a good/bad thing, but a difference for sure.
